92 4WD PU Lurches and hesitates??

Hi, i am a relatively new Toyota owner. I bought a 92 kingcab 4wd 6 cylinder 5 speed about 6 months ago. She just broke 100, 000 miles I love my truck and will never go back to anything else. The problem I am having is the truck lurches and hesitates. I thought for sure it was the fuel filter so I changed that but it didn't help. Plugs look fine although I haven't done any maintaince on her except change oil. She looks well taken care of. She idles great just sitting there but when I go to take off she starts lurching just like it was a fuel filter problem. She kicks and bucks as i shift through the gears. Once I get her into 4th and am going 55 miles an hour she runs fine except about every 10-15 seconds she gives a lurch or a buck? Is this a TP sensor problem or oxygen sensor? There are not many folks around here that work on Toyotas. Thanks guys!! Dan
